How reliable is the Honda Jazz?

Honda dealers always get excellent reports, and Honda as a brand is consistently at or near the top of most reliability surveys. In our most recent one, the firm ranked surprisingly mid-table finishing 14th out of 30 manufacturers, although the Jazz came fifth out of 24 cars in the small cars category.

Does Honda Jazz have timing belt or chain?

Answered by CarsGuide

For those who prefer solid, low-maintenance motoring, the news is good, because all three Australian-delivered generations of the Honda Jazz have used the company's L series engines which feature a timing chain rather than a rubber timing belt.

Does Honda have transmission problems?

The most common cause of failure in a Honda automatic transmission is a malfunctioning torque converter, which can cause shifting problems in automatic transmissions. The torque converter in an automatic transmission serves the same purpose as the clutch in a manual transmission.

Why is Honda discontinuing the fit?

Honda cites slow sales as its reason for dropping the Fit; so far in 2020, sales are down 19 percent to just 13,887 units. In 2019, Honda sold 35,414 units, compared with the HR-V's 99,104 units sold. We can assume that the HR-V is also more profitable for Honda, as its base price is $22,040 to the Fit's $17,145.
